On the Annunciation


The Solemnity of the Annunciation is significantly important in our reflection on Christ's Incarnation as Man. It looks forward nine months to our observance of Christ's Nativity. Our Lord took flesh in the womb of Mary, full of grace. The Blessed Virgin Mary guarantees Christ's humanity and, because He shared in our humanity, we can, by grace, come to share His divinity. This is why the Blessed Virgin, Theotokos, was central to the christological controversies of early Christianity.

From the Collect of the Mass for the Annunciation (New Translation):
O God, who willed that your Word should take on the reality of human flesh in the womb of the Virgin Mary, grant, we pray, that we, who confess our Redeemer to be God and man, may merit to become partakers even in his divine nature.
